CPC H04L 65/752 (2022.05) [E04H 3/126 (2013.01); G06F 15/16 (2013.01); H04L 12/1831 (2013.01); H04L 51/04 (2013.01); H04L 51/10 (2013.01); H04L 51/216 (2022.05); H04L 51/226 (2022.05); H04L 51/42 (2022.05); H04L 61/2503 (2013.01); H04L 65/1083 (2013.01); H04L 65/4015 (2013.01); H04L 65/403 (2013.01); H04L 65/764 (2022.05); H04L 67/54 (2022.05); H04M 1/64 (2013.01); H04M 3/53 (2013.01); H04M 3/5307 (2013.01); H04M 11/00 (2013.01); H04N 7/147 (2013.01); H04N 7/15 (2013.01); H04W 4/12 (2013.01)] | 20 Claims |
1. A method of operating a communication system over a network, the method comprising:
distributing a plurality of mobile communication devices to a plurality of users respectively, each of the plurality of mobile communication devices including a display, a processor, and executable instructions stored in memory for execution by the processor;
maintaining a communication infrastructure on the network, the communication infrastructure configured to selectively wirelessly communicate with the plurality of mobile communication devices respectively;
receiving voice media at the communication infrastructure from a sender using a sending communication device, the voice media intended for an intended recipient using a recipient mobile communication device, the intended recipient one of the plurality of users and the recipient mobile communication device one of the plurality of mobile communication devices,
the intended recipient identified by the sender using identifier information associated with the intended recipient,
the voice media transmitted by the sending communication device before an end-to-end connection is established over the network between the sending communication device and the recipient mobile communication device:
using voice recognition software to transcribe, within the communication infrastructure on the network, the voice media into text media as the voice media is received by the communication infrastructure, the voice recognition software transcribing the voice media into the text media without human assistance;
providing the text media to the recipient mobile communication device as the voice media is transcribed, wherein at least some of the text media is provided to the recipient mobile communication device without the establishment of the end-to-end connection between the sending communication device and the recipient mobile communication device,
progressively displaying the text media on the display of the recipient mobile communication device as the voice media is transmitted by the sending communication device, received and transcribed by the communication infrastructure, and provided to the second recipient mobile communication device.
|